Democritus thought matter could be divided into. . smaller and smaller pieces until a . single indivisible . particle is reached. . He named this particle the . atom. He proposed that atoms are of different sizes, in constant motion, and separated by empty spaces.. With thanks to Isaac Asimov. As easy as LMN. Shortcomings of the Bohr Model. Bohr’s model was too simple. Worked . well with only hydrogen because H only has one . electron.
